We're wanting to book a holiday in Barbados next November. We've been saving for this for a while - it's kind of a delayed honeymoon - so I'm really wanting not to make a mistake!!

We have 2 kids who will be 2.10 and 1.3 at the time of the holiday. We would rather go all inclusive, and would definitely like to be able to use a kids club occasionally.

I've found Almond Beach Village which sounds like it meets the bill (esp as it has a 'nursery' kids club which we can't find elsewhere), but now I've just seen that they will be opening a newly refurbished Almond Casuarina resort this year. Obviously there are no reviews yet on e.g. Tripadvisor about this hotel.

So...does anyone have any advice as to whether we should go for the established AB Village (which some say is a bit 'tired') or for the new Almond Casuarina (which is unchartered territory and is also on the 'inferior'(??) south coast). They have the same star rating with Virgin, but Casuarina is a bit cheaper.

Any advice would be welcomed!
